Who is Dubs?
Dubs is the 14th official live mascot of the University of Washington. He is an Alaskan Malamute from Snohomish, Washington. Born on January 4, 2018, he was adopted into a family of UW alumni and now resides in Sammamish, Washington. He has two human siblings and two furry siblings.
